Already in medieval times, the near-by village of Predoi engaged in copper ore mining. This resulted in an never experienced boom, lasting for more than 5 centuries. But with the advance of the American copper mines the once flowering local mining industry came to a sudden dead halt. In 1993, the Valle Aurina copper mine had to be closed. Today, the former corn bin hosts an interesting mining museum, which introduces the visitors to the hard life of mine workers.
